1845 Folded cross-border cover sent April 1 from Oswego, NY to the Warden at Kingston Penitentiary, rated manuscript ‘12½’(¢ US for 80 – 150 miles), converted to ‘11d’ collect (7½d postage rate plus a ½d or 2½% EXCHANGE SURCHARGE, plus 3d ferriage charge at Kingston), filing folds, otherwise fine and a scarce rate cover (2½% surcharge was only in effect from May ‘42 to Dec ’43). 1845 Folded cross-border cover sent April 12 from Oswego, NY to the Warden at Kingston Penitentiary, rated ‘25’(¢ US) as a double letter (80-150 miles), converted to ‘1/3’ plus a 2½% EXCHANGE SURCHARGE, which should have been only 1/3½ but instead the ½d was added to each single rate, making a total of 1/4 plus the 3d ferriage charge = total ‘1/7’ collect, filing folds and one tape repair, otherwise a fine and very scarce rate cover, (2½% surcharge was only in effect from May ‘42 to Dec ’43). 1855 Much-forwarded cross border envelope from Philadelphia 5 AP to Guelph (manuscript 'via Hamilton'), rated '10' (cents US) and 6D (Cdn) received 6 AP 1855 and FORWARDED to Galt, received 3 JY and FORWARDED again to Aylmer, finally received (manuscript date) 26 July, forwarding charge manuscript notations 'For'd', 'T 6d' and manuscript pencil '6', a total of nine c.d.s. cancels on front or back, with contents, some cover edge faults, still a fine and attractive cover. 1855 Decorative cross-border envelope with EMBOSSED FANCY 'LACE-LIKE' frame all around the address panel, sent from Rochester 11 AP to Ingersoll, Canada West, US markings include manuscript '10' plus straight line 'PAID' and rate '10' handstamps, with bright red two-line Canadian 'UNITED STATES PAID 6D' exchange office marking on front plus 13 AP receiver on back, tiny age spot UL and a couple of light corner rumples, still very fine and tremendously attractive.
